Bloch sphere representation of three-vertex geometric phases

Published 27 Jul 2011 in quant-ph | (1107.5447v1)

Abstract: The properties of the geometric phases between three quantum states are investigated in a high-dimensional Hilbert space using the Majorana representation of symmetric quantum states. We found that the geometric phases between the three quantum states in an N-state quantum system can be represented by N-1 spherical triangles on the Bloch sphere. The parameter dependence of the geometric phase was analyzed based on this picture. We found that the geometric phase exhibits rich nonlinear behavior in a high-dimensional Hilbert space.
